One Week, 7 Hairstyles

Don't you just hate those days, staring in the mirror and looking back at dull, drab, boring hair? I know I do. We all lack a bit of hair-spiration from time to time so I've created a challenge: A week of hairstyles. Simple, quick and easy hairstyles. So go on, give it a go!

Monday - Half up Half down
This quick and easy style looks chic and stylish. This versatile hairstyle looks great with any type of hair; curly, wavy or straight.


Tuesday - Poker Straight
It's time for the hair straighteners. This look is great for the work place and can be softened up with a hair accessory. Channel Gossip Girl style by accessorizing with a colourful hair band.


Wednesday - Low ponytail
A low ponytail looks sleek and professional whilst remaining light and fun.Wrap the extra strand around the bobble and secure with a bobby pin for an extra savvy look.


Thursday - Sleek bun
Get out the hairspray, it's time for a sleek bun. Wear it high or low, your choice. This look is super quick but looks super classy.



Friday - Waves
Get ready for the weekend with some beach-babe waves. Plaiting wet hair, crimpers or even flat irons can create this amazing chilled style.


Saturday - Bouncy curls
It's the weekend, it's time to let your hair down. Soft bouncy curls can go right through from day to night. Use curling tongs or twist a flat iron a bit of mousse and hairspray and you're good to go.


Sunday - Plaits, Plaits, Plaits
Check out the pictures below, YouTube or, to be honest, anywhere on the internet for some amazing braided looks. Anything with braids goes today so it's time to experiment!
